The Rev. Professor George Alexander Johnston Ross, M.A., of the Union Theological Seminary, of New York City, will conduct the service in Appleton Chapel tomorrow morning at 11 o'clock, and will also lead morning prayers the rest of the week and the week following at 8.45 o'clock.
Officers of the University and their families should enter by the north side door, students and their friends by the south side door. The balconies only are open to the public.
